<p>As babytitain said, the New York Times puts [the</a> numbers](<a href=“http://thechoice.blogs.nytimes.com/2011/03/30/admit-stats-2011/]the”>Stanford and Duke Accepted How Many? Colleges Report 2011 Admission Figures - The New York Times) as follows:</p>
<p>Applied: 23,726
Accepted: 6,965
Rate: 29%</p>
<p>This year’s incoming first-year class was 3,946 people, so if they’re aiming for something similar they’re projecting a 56% yield (or slightly less, if you consider wait lists, etc.), which is [very</a> strong](<a href=“http://talk.collegeconfidential.com/college-search-selection/429673-acceptance-rates-yield-rates-top-usnwr-nat-l-unis-lacs.html]very”>http://talk.collegeconfidential.com/college-search-selection/429673-acceptance-rates-yield-rates-top-usnwr-nat-l-unis-lacs.html).</p>
